Paulo Henrique has been ruled out of Vasco’s trip to Internacional after scans confirmed a mild sprain of his right ankle.

According to Globo.com, the full-back has not travelled to Porto Alegre, remaining in Rio de Janeiro for intensive treatment with the club’s Department of Health and Performance (DESP).

He was injured in a collision with Paysandu left-back Bonifazi three minutes into the second half of the Copa do Brasil tie that sent Vasco into the last 16. He left the pitch in tears and was replaced by Puma Rodríguez.

After Wednesday’s game he sought to play down the problem and departed São Januário without immobilisation, though he had been wearing protection on the ankle beforehand. He later reported pain.

Internacional host Vasco at Beira-Rio on Saturday at 6.30pm, Brasília time, in round 16 of the Campeonato Brasileiro. Renato Gaúcho’s side are eighth on 20 points.
